He has been painting and drawing all his life. He learned the craft at the hands of great masters: Josep Perpinyà, Julià Cutiller, and Francesc Vila.
For years he has combined his artistic activity with teaching, vocations he has always managed to combine successfully.
Since then, his work has achieved broad reach thanks to his exhibitions.
He works intensively and expands his professional horizons by dedicating himself to graphic design. In 2014, he won first prize for Ex Libris in the art contest organized by the Amics de la Unesco association. He has also worked on book illustrations (Els pobles del Baix Empordà by Maruja Arnau, Retalls de Premsa per al capvespre by Àngel Caldas).
He currently has more than thirty solo exhibitions and countless group shows to his credit. His work is held in private collections across various European countries and throughout Spain.
In 2016, his international recognition began at the Art Revolution Taipei 2016 International Art Fair. That same year, he exhibited part of his work at the Kelti Art Center, Bellavita Art Gallery, X-Power Art Gallery, and Get Art Museum in Taipei, Taiwan.
In 2017, on the occasion of celebrating his 30 years of painting, the book Toni Cassany. 30 anys de pintura by writer David Pagès i Cassú was published and presented at the El Claustre gallery in Girona.
